My baby boy is 10 months old and is teeth is getting black can I know wats the reason for this n y it's causing black??

A. baby teeth can become discolored for many reasons, including: 1.inadequate brushing. if baby teeth aren't brushed properly. bacterial infection can cause such black staining of tooth due to decay. 2.medication use. infant medications containing iron, such as supplemental vitamins, might cause stains on baby teeth. 3.tooth injury. a single dark tooth could be the resulth of bleeding within the tooth due to dental trauma. h 4.illness. long standing disease illness as well as nutritional deficiencies can cause pigmentation of the tooth.
